Abstract

The aim of this paper is to plan and build programmed missile tracking and detection framework. This framework is intended to distinguish the object (rocket) moving in different directions. The target terminating framework moves consequently towards rocket and fires it after fixing the target. This framework comprises of an intelligent sonar based tracking framework that persistently screens the target. After identifying the target, it sends the location to a central control system. The central control system makes the action of moving the terminating component toward target (missile). After settling the direction, it sends the control order to terminating the framework for assaulting the target.Cite this Article N Dinesh Kumar, Rangaraju BhanuTeja, P. Venu Laxman Goud.
